Systematic dissection of biases in whole-exome and whole-genome sequencing reveals major determinants of coding sequence coverage
2018-08-09
Abstract excerpt
Next generation DNA sequencing technologies are rapidly transforming the world of human genomics. Advantages and diagnostic effectiveness of the two most widely used resequencing approaches, whole exome (WES) and whole genome (WGS) sequencing, are still frequently debated. In our study we developed a set of statistical tools to systematically assess coverage of CDS regions provided by several modern WES platforms,...
